Transcribed Image Text:An uncrowned straight-bevel pinion has 20 teeth, a
diametral pitch of 20 teeth, and a transmission accuracy
number of 6. Both the pinion and gear are made of
through-hardened steel with a Brinell hardness of 300.
The driven gear has 60 teeth. The gear set has a life goal
of 10° revolutions of the pinion with a reliability of 0.999.
The shaft angle is 900; the pinion speed is 900 rev/min.
The face width is 32 mm, and the normal pressure angle
is 20°. The pinion is mounted outboard of its bearings,
and the gear is straddle-mounted. Based on the AGMA
bending strength, what is the power rating of the gear
set? Use Ko = 1, SF = 1, and SH = 1.
